Chicken Hoppin' John

Prep: 15 min Cook: 40 min Serves: 4 Cuisine: American

A hearty Southern-inspired dish combining tender chicken, smoky bacon, flavorful black-eyed peas, and aromatic herbs, perfect for comforting family dinners or casual gatherings.

Ingredients

  • 1 pkg. cut up chicken
  • 2 slices bacon
  • 1/2 tsp. salt
  • 1/8 tsp. pepper
  • 1/2 cup uncooked rice
  • 1/2 cup chopped onion
  • 1 Tbsp. chicken broth
  • 2 cups hot water
  • 1/8 tsp. hot sauce
  • 1 can black-eyed peas, drained
  • 1/4 cup chopped parsley
  • 1/2 tsp. thyme leaves, crushed

Instructions

  1. Cook bacon in a large pan until crisp.
  2. Remove bacon, drain, crumble, and set aside.
  3. Drain all but 2 tablespoons of drippings from the pan.
  4. In the same pan, add chicken and cook, turning until browned on all sides.
  5. Sprinkle chicken with salt and pepper.
  6. Reduce heat to low, cover, and simmer chicken for 15 minutes.
  7. Add rice and chopped onion to the pan, stir in chicken broth and hot sauce.
  8. Pour the rice mixture over the chicken in the pan.
  9. In a bowl, mix black-eyed peas, chopped parsley, and crushed thyme.
  10. Add the black-eyed pea mixture to the pan and stir gently to combine.
  11. Cover and cook for about 25 minutes longer, or until everything is tender.
  12. Sprinkle the cooked bacon on top and serve.
